CPU comparisonIntel Xeon D-1736NT or AMD EPYC 7282 - which processor is faster? In this comparison we look at the differences and analyze which of these two CPUs is better. We compare the technical data and benchmark results.
The Intel Xeon D-1736NT has 8 cores with 16 threads and clocks with a maximum frequency of 3.50 GHz. Up to 256 GB of memory is supported in 2 memory channels. The Intel Xeon D-1736NT was released in Q1/2022. The AMD EPYC 7282 has 16 cores with 32 threads and clocks with a maximum frequency of 3.20 GHz. The CPU supports up to GB of memory in 8 memory channels. The AMD EPYC 7282 was released in Q3/2019. |

CPU Cores and Base FrequencyThe Intel Xeon D-1736NT has 8 CPU cores and can calculate 16 threads in parallel. The clock frequency of the Intel Xeon D-1736NT is 2.70 GHz (3.50 GHz) while the AMD EPYC 7282 has 16 CPU cores and 32 threads can calculate simultaneously. The clock frequency of the AMD EPYC 7282 is at 2.80 GHz (3.20 GHz). |

Memory & PCIeThe Intel Xeon D-1736NT can use up to 256 GB of memory in 2 memory channels. The maximum memory bandwidth is 42.7 GB/s. The AMD EPYC 7282 supports up to GB of memory in 8 memory channels and achieves a memory bandwidth of up to 51.2 GB/s. |

Thermal ManagementThe thermal design power (TDP for short) of the Intel Xeon D-1736NT is 67 W, while the AMD EPYC 7282 has a TDP of 120 W. The TDP specifies the necessary cooling solution that is required to cool the processor sufficiently. |

Technical detailsThe Intel Xeon D-1736NT is manufactured in 10 nm and has 15.00 MB cache. The AMD EPYC 7282 is manufactured in 7 nm and has a 64.00 MB cache. |
